Foxy Brown Talks Freedom

The MC spoke to MTV as soon as she was released from Prison...

Rapper Foxy Brown spoke to MTV News last week an hour after being released from New York's Rikers Island, where she served eight months of her year-long sentence for probation violations.

The 29 year old MC was given three years probation after an attack on two Manhattan nail salon stylists in 2004 and jailed last September when she was accused of hitting a woman with a mobile phone.

Calling from a white Bentley, Foxy, aka Inga Marchand, told us: "Oh man, it feels effin' incredible... I have a whole newfound respect for my freedom.

Even though 76 days of her sentence was spent in solitary confinement, Foxy said that the hardest part of being in prison was overcoming perceptions about her, even her own: "While I was incarcerated It was just me. I had no nails on. It was just literally me in the flesh. I guess that was the hardest part, just even with Foxy trying to find Inga."

Brown said she was feeling positive and had learned from her mistakes "I feel really good about my growth, and I feel change is the essence of maturation," she said. "I feel that I went through an enormous change, and I'm really excited."

Her prison exit on Saturday was filmed by VH1 for a new reality TV show.
